Broken or damaged panes

Double-glazed windows are made up of two panes with an air space between them, which is filled with inert gases like Krypton and argon. This allows heat to flow through the window, while slowing it down to ensure that it doesn't heat your house too much.

This assembly can be damaged or destroyed which can cause condensation between the window panes or a draft coming from the window. If it's not replaced immediately, this will not only affect the way your home is insulated but will also raise your energy costs.

Fortunately, the majority of double glazing repairs can be carried out by an expert. However you should be able to identify the root of the issue. It is recommended to inspect your windows at least once per year to look for signs of damage. This could be a crack in the glass or a loose seal. In addition, you will notice condensation between the panes or feel the draft in your house. It is best to consult an expert rather than try to fix the problem yourself.

One thing to be aware of is that a cracked window pane could break into large pieces. This is due to tension stresses that happen when the glass is stretched out too far. To avoid this occurring, you must replace a window pane when it is damaged, rather than waiting.

To repair damaged or broken windows pane, you must first clean the frame. It is important to wear gloves to shield your hands from cuts. Remove any old caulking or putty from the frame's edges. Once the frame has been made you can then add new putty to the frame and replace the window pane.

Some companies offer drilling for double glazing that is misted up in order to draw out the moisture inside. This is a temporary solution and won't improve the performance of double glazing. The best solution is finding a specialist in double glazing repair who is reliable and knowledgeable and having them refurbish the window as well as its components.

Seals

The window seals prevent heat from leaking through the panes of a triple or double-paned window. If a window is damaged condensation and air could be trapped between the panes. This is not only unattractive, but also affects your home's insulation properties. If you find a damaged window seal, it is important to get the problem fixed as soon as you can.

Many people believe they can repair the double-glazed seal by themselves but this isn't always a wise option. Double-glazed windows are an intricate system that requires a trained and skilled tradesperson to fix. If you attempt to repair it yourself, you may end up making the issue worse or creating more damage to your windows. It is recommended to leave this kind of work to professionals, and you can use our free service to find the best tradesperson to complete the task.

Window seals that aren't working properly usually announce themselves loudly, causing a build-up of condensation between the glass panes that can't be wiped away. It is also typical for windows that has a leaky seal to have a cloudy or wavy appearance that distorts the view from outside or inside of your home. Seals that fail not only appear ugly, but they also reduce the insulating properties of your window. This makes your house more expensive and difficult to heat and cool.

In certain cases you might be able to repair the window seal without having to replace the whole frame. If the window is under warranty, or you have a guarantee from the company that installed it, then they can often come to your home and replace the seal for free.

It is important to inspect your window seals on a regular basis, and especially if your window is 15-20 years old or older. This is because they become less durable over time, and could cause a range of issues, including drafts, fogging, as well as high energy bills. Some window seals can be left to stand. However, it is recommended to repair double glazed window them as soon you notice the issue.

Frames

It could be possible to fix your frames if they're damaged or broken instead of replacing the entire window. Local double glazing repair services can provide quick and effective solutions. They can also provide suggestions on how to maintain your windows and doors. You will have a wide variety of styles and colours to choose from.

In a survey of double-glazing owners they reported issues with the frames and mechanisms. This included windows becoming difficult to open and close, doors falling down or sagging as time passes. These issues can be solved by lubricating handles or hinges, or re-screwing loose fixings. If the issue continues, it is recommended to have an expert examine the issue.

Another common complaint was the frames that let draughts enter the room or allowing cold, damp air to enter. You can lessen this by installing trickle vents or adding insulation to the walls surrounding your windows. Some have tried to block out the cold by covering their windows with blinds or curtains however this can lead to mould and condensation.

Misted double glazing is typically caused by a build-up of moisture between the glass panes. This could be due to condensation, seals that are dirty or a combination of. It is important to fix the problem as soon as you can if your double glazing has begun to fog. If moisture isn't dealt with it may be leaking into the cavity, causing wood rot.

The most efficient method to clean windows frames is to use a damp cloth. This will get rid of the majority of grime and dirt, but if the frames are especially difficult to remove or have deep grooves, you could try cleaning fluid. Try the cleaning fluid first on a small portion of the frame. This will ensure that the cleaning fluid won't harm or cause damage to the frame.

Repairing double-glazed windows is an excellent way to improve their energy efficiency while still looking like new. It's also a cheaper option than replacing the entire window.

Glass

Double-glazed windows offer a variety of advantages, including reducing energy consumption and making your home more peaceful. However, they can experience issues from time to time like misty glass or condensation between the panes. In these cases it's usually best to opt instead for targeted maintenance rather than replacement. However, it's important to remember that you should only trust a professional double glazing company to repair your window. This is because specialist tools are needed and it is important that the repair is carried out properly.

In the majority of instances replacing a damaged double-glazed panel is not enough. For example, it will also require the restoration of the energy efficiency of the window by removing the old seals and replacing them with new. If your double glased window glazed windows have been rated as inefficient It is recommended that you call the company from which you bought them as soon as you can and explain the problem. It can be done in person, via phone or via email.

If you are lucky, the company will send someone to fix your window, free of charge or for a very small cost. In some cases, the company may not be able help you and may recommend that you completely replace your window. This will most likely happen if the window is severely damaged or is afflicted with mould or rot.

You may be able repair the crack yourself in certain cases using heavy-duty tape. This will prevent superficial cracks, like stress cracks caused by low temperatures from getting worse. You should use a strong-hold tape such as masking tape, and then extend it beyond the crack on both sides to hold it in place.

Double-glazed window crack repair can be achieved by applying epoxy to the damaged area. This option is more labor-intensive, but can make your cracked window appear brand new after it is repaired. Before doing this, you should clean around and over the cracked glass with soap and water. Follow the instructions on the epoxy and apply it evenly on both surfaces.
